Operating History: The reinforced concrete structure contained the reactor and supporting systems. The building contained four main elevations.

Residual radioactive material was known to be present on all levels of the interior of the building.

Operating records and the HSA document several events with the potential for a release of radioactivity inside this structure.

No events documenting exterior contamination were found.Site Characterization:

Direct measurements were made of each of the interior elevation surfaces as well as the exterior surfaces of the structure.

These measurements confirmed the presence of plant-derived radionuclides.

Direct measurements on the -27' elevation showed a mean gross activity level of 1,535,383 dpm/100 cm2 and a maximum value of 8,134,000 dpmI100 cm2. Direct measurements on the grade elevation showed a mean gross activity level of 201,670 dpm/100 cm2 and a maximum value of 370,000 dpm/100 cm2. Direct measurements on the +40' elevation showed a mean gross activity level of 51,521 dpm/100 cm2 and a maximum value of 99,150 dpm/100 cm2. Direct measurements on the +60' elevation showed a mean gross activity level of 20,110 dpm/100 cm2 and a maximum value of 46,660 dpm!l00 cm2. Direct measurements on the exterior roof showed a mean gross activity level of 1,364 dpm/100 cm2 and a maximum value of 1,571 dpm/100 cm2. Based on the classification procedure (DSIP-0020) and levels of gross activity reported, the interior of the reactor building was determined to be a Class 1 area and the exterior was a! Class 3.HSA Events: HSA Report pg. 63.Survey Unit Design Information:

As stated in Chapter 4 of the LTP, as long as the residual activity within the survey unit is less than the DCGL (i.e. the survey unit average activity is less than the DCGL and the EMC criterion has been met), the ALARA criterion has been met.Changes in Initial Survey Unit Assumptions:

The survey unit was designed as a Class 1 structure survey and the sample results are consistent with that classification.

The variability of the survey results was less than the characterization data used for survey design. Forty-four potential areas of elevated activity were detected and evaluated as shown in Attachment

3. Therefore the EMC criterion was met.Conclusion:

The FSS of this survey unit was properly designed as a Class 1 survey based on Table 5-4 of the LTP. The required number of direct measurements was made and the scan coverage met the requirement of Table 5-6 of the LTP! No direct measurements exceeded the DCGL of 43,000 dpm/100 cm 2 and none of the removable surface activity measurements exceeded 10% of the DCGL. Forty-four' investigations were required.The direct measurement data support rejection of the null hypothesis, providing high confidence that the survey unit satisfied the release criteria andthat the data quality objectives were met.-It is concluded that survey unit F8110113 meets the release criteria of 1OCFR20.1402.

2) Fraction Survey Unit Remainder DCGL = SU Mean =43,000 2,004 0.047 EMC Unity Sum 0.122'Grid 152 (2 m by 2 m area) was initially greater than the DCGLEMc. Investigation of the area resulted in the decision to perform additional remediation.

The area was resurveyed as grids 330 and 331. Beta scan activity for these grids ranged from 5,961 to 15,785 dpm/100 cm 2 , based on a surveyor efficiency of 0.5 and no background subtracted.

The reported investigation result is based on the average count rate of the two grids and represents the residual radioactivity levels following additional remediation.

2 Grid 176 (2 m by 2 m area) was initially greater than the DCGLEMC. Investigation of the area resulted in the decision to perform additional remediation.

The area was resurveyed as grids 221 to 260. Beta scan activity for these grids ranged from 2,460 to 14,913 dpm/100 cm 2 , based on a surveyor efficiency of 0.5 and no background subtracted.

The reported investigation result is based on the average count rate of the 40 grids and represents the residual radioactivity levels following additional remediation.

3Grids 198, 199 and 202 (adjacent 2 m by 2 m areas) were initially greater than the DCGLEMc. Measurements for 198 and 199 were not logged.Investigation of the area resulted in the decision to perform additional remediation.

These grids were resurveyed as 261 to 326. Beta scan activity-for- these grids ranged from. 3,159-to.-24-1,725-dpm/100 cm- , based. on a surveyor efficiency-of-0.5 and no-backgroundsubtracted. .Grids exceeding 2 43,000 dpm/100 cm are further annotated in the above table. The investigation results for these grids represent the-residual radioactivity levels following the remediation.
